Re: [libav-devel] [PATCH 04/15] lavr: x86: optimized 6-channel s16p to flt conversion

2012-08-21 Thread Ronald S. Bultje
Hi, On Sun, Aug 5, 2012 at 9:52 PM, Justin Ruggles justin.rugg...@gmail.com wrote: --- libavresample/x86/audio_convert.asm| 106 libavresample/x86/audio_convert_init.c | 15 + 2 files changed, 121 insertions(+), 0 deletions(-) LGTM. Ronald

[libav-devel] [PATCH 04/15] lavr: x86: optimized 6-channel s16p to flt conversion

2012-08-05 Thread Justin Ruggles
--- libavresample/x86/audio_convert.asm| 106 libavresample/x86/audio_convert_init.c | 15 + 2 files changed, 121 insertions(+), 0 deletions(-) diff --git a/libavresample/x86/audio_convert.asm b/libavresample/x86/audio_convert.asm index

Re: [libav-devel] [PATCH 04/15] lavr: x86: optimized 6-channel s16p to flt conversion

2012-07-25 Thread Justin Ruggles
On 07/24/2012 11:58 PM, Ronald S. Bultje wrote: Hi, On Sat, Jul 21, 2012 at 12:12 PM, Justin Ruggles justin.rugg...@gmail.com wrote: +%if cpuflag(ssse3) +pshufb m3, m0, unpack_odd ; m3 = 12, 13, 14, 15 +pshufb m0, unpack_even ; m0 = 0, 1, 2,

Re: [libav-devel] [PATCH 04/15] lavr: x86: optimized 6-channel s16p to flt conversion

2012-07-24 Thread Ronald S. Bultje
Hi, On Sat, Jul 21, 2012 at 12:12 PM, Justin Ruggles justin.rugg...@gmail.com wrote: +%if cpuflag(ssse3) +pshufb m3, m0, unpack_odd ; m3 = 12, 13, 14, 15 +pshufb m0, unpack_even ; m0 = 0, 1, 2, 3 +pshufb m4, m1, unpack_odd ; m4 =

[libav-devel] [PATCH 04/15] lavr: x86: optimized 6-channel s16p to flt conversion

2012-07-21 Thread Justin Ruggles
--- libavresample/x86/audio_convert.asm| 106 libavresample/x86/audio_convert_init.c | 15 + 2 files changed, 121 insertions(+), 0 deletions(-) diff --git a/libavresample/x86/audio_convert.asm b/libavresample/x86/audio_convert.asm index

Re: [libav-devel] [PATCH 04/15] lavr: x86: optimized 6-channel s16p to flt conversion

2012-07-16 Thread Loren Merritt
On Sun, 15 Jul 2012, Justin Ruggles wrote: +shufps m1, m0, m2, q2020 ; m1 = 0, 1, 12, 13, 2, 3, 14, 15 +shufps m0, m4, q2031 ; m0 = 6, 7, 18, 19, 4, 5, 16, 17 +shufps m2, m4, q3131 ; m2 = 8, 9, 20, 21, 10, 11, 22, 23 +

[libav-devel] [PATCH 04/15] lavr: x86: optimized 6-channel s16p to flt conversion

2012-07-14 Thread Justin Ruggles
--- libavresample/x86/audio_convert.asm| 83 libavresample/x86/audio_convert_init.c |9 2 files changed, 92 insertions(+), 0 deletions(-) diff --git a/libavresample/x86/audio_convert.asm b/libavresample/x86/audio_convert.asm index 52528fa..ba6cb60